Historic Property
Street Address:
Beech Island vicinity, SW side SC 145, .9 mi. SE of int. w/SC 65

Site Number:
S108042001300033
Site Number:
6.038
Date Surveyed:
1986-04-17
Category:
Building
Construction Date:
1825
Historic Use:
Residential/Domestic
Current Use:
Residential/Domestic
Architectural Style:
Federal Classicism
Construction Method:
Frame
Foundation Materials:
Brick Piers
Roof Materials:
Patterned metal
Date of Boundary Increase:
No Boundary Increase
Signficant Architectural Features:
2 story frame residence, rectangular w/1 story "L“ wing to rear, 1 story shed addn. to rear, 1 story shed addn. to side; 5 bays wide (1st: W-W-E-W-W, 2nd: W-W-W-W-W) at main block, 2 bays deep (1st: W-E, 2nd: W-W); side gable patterned metal roof; 2 ext. brick chimneys at main block, rear shed addn. has 1 ext. br chimney, rear wing has 1 int. brick chimney, side wing has 1 int. brick stove flue; 1 story hipped porch along the facade w/fluted wood columns & wood Doric balustrade, similar smaller entry portico at side entrance (columns not fluted at side); 1st level-9/9 sash windows w/molded surrounds & molded hoods, 2nd level 9/6; central entrance has elaborate entablature surround w/transom & sidelights, panelled entry door; wood weatherboard siding, flush board siding inside porch; stuccoed masonry fndtn; simple boxed cornice w/double dentil frieze; ALSO-approx 20 yds behind house is small frame 1x2 bay shed; approx 20 yds to one side of it is another small rectangular outbldg w/louvers on side; approx. 35 yds from house is small 1 by 1 bay frame outbldg w/ext. brick chimney w/corbelled cap; small spring house OUTBUILDINGS: 1 smokehouse, 1 silo, 1 service bldg, 1 commissary, 1 spring house
Alterations:
Rear porch screened in, additions
Historical Information:
House constructed ca. 1825 by the Glover Family; Glovers were early settlers in the area & owned a great deal of land; orig. land reportedly received as a grant from the King of England prior to the Rev. War.
